Raiders' Tyree Wilson Faces Make-or-Break Preseason in 2025

As the 2025 NFL preseason approaches, all eyes are on Las Vegas Raiders' third-year EDGE Tyree Wilson. The former 7th overall pick in the 2023 draft has failed to meet the high expectations attached to his selection, and the upcoming season represents a make-or-break moment for the young defensive standout.

Wilson's first two years in the league have been underwhelming, with the Texas Tech product recording just 3.5 sacks as a rookie and a slightly improved 4.5 sacks in 2024. The Raiders' front office has undergone significant changes since Wilson was drafted, and the new regime led by John Spytek and Pete Carroll has little reason to show extended patience with the talented but raw defensive end.

With Maxx Crosby and Malcolm Koonce firmly entrenched as the Raiders' starting EDGE rushers, Wilson will need to make the most of his opportunities during the preseason to earn more playing time. The team's recent release of defensive tackle Christian Wilkins could open the door for Wilson to showcase his versatility and become a disruptive force up the middle. However, the realistic best-case scenario for the 2025 season sees Wilson develop into a quality rotational rusher, a role he must prove he can excel in.

As the Raiders prepare for the upcoming campaign, the progress (or lack thereof) of Tyree Wilson will be a key storyline to monitor throughout the preseason. The third-year pro's ability to finally live up to his draft pedigree could determine the trajectory of his career in Las Vegas.
